VSU Volleyball Ends Regular Season at .500 After 3-1 Victory Over Bowie State

Kelsea Saulny earned a pair of career high's in kills (8) and blocks (5) in final game of the regular season

BOWIE, MD – The VSU Volleyball team moves to 15-15 in the regular season after spoiling the senior night of Bowie State (25-21, 20-25, 25-13, 25-11)


Game Notes
  • Helena Eubanks led the match with a team-high 11 kills which marks her tenth double-digit kill match while Kennedy Hoge added eight.
  • Kelsea Saulny earned career-high's in kills with eight and blocks with five as she posted a miraculous .600 hitting percentage.
  • Both Zaria Irons and Alexis Baker ended the match with three service aces while Kennedy Hoge posted two.
  • Emma Quarles led the team with 18 assists while Makenzy Johnson was just two away with 16
  • Najlaa Williams earned 20 or more digs for the fourth time this season leading the match with 20.

 
How It Happened
SET 1 | After a back-and-fourth start to the match, the Bulldogs went ahead after scoring four points straight to go up 7-3. The set saw six more ties until the Trojans scored four points straight to go up 18-15 led by kills from Helena Eubanks and Amaya Cooper. As the Bulldogs cut the lead to two points, the Trojans scored three straight points to stretch their lead out to 22-17. Kennedy Hoge, Makenzy Johnson and Alexis McNair teamed up with kills to end the set at 25-21

SET 2 | Bowie State earned the early lead 8-4 out of the gate in the second set. After the Trojans fought back to bring the score 8-7, BSU went on a 4-0 run to make it 12-7. The Trojans scored six of eight points to bring the BSU lead to just one at 14-13. With the score at 19 all, BSU scored five straight to take set two 25-20.

SET 3 | The Trojans jumped out to an early 7-3 lead thanks to kills from Helena Eubanks and Kelsea Saulny. VSU was able to keep the Bulldogs at arm's length as they moved the score to 21-10 after going on a 5-1 run. The Trojans went on to close out the set 25-13 after scoring four of the last five points of the set.
 
SET 4 | With the score tied at five, Najlaa Williams earned back-to-back service aces which played a part in the 5-0 run of the Trojans to make the score 10-5. Later in the set, the Trojans got hot again scoring six of seven points to extend their lead to 20-10. The Trojans would go on to five points straight to end the set at 25-11.


What's Next
As the Trojans stand tall at third in the Northern Division of the CIAA, they await their Quarterfinals opponent. The CIAA playoffs start on Monday, October 7 at a time and location to be announced.
